Facebook is launching a new data product for marketers that shows what users are saying about brands, products, events and more. Dubbed “Topic Data,” the product could enhance marketing campaigns, says this Wall Street Journal article, but it also could provide data and research that might inform TV ads or bring in entirely new audiences.

The social network said Wednesday it’s launching a new data product called “Topic Data,” which will show marketers what users on Facebook are saying about brands, products, events, activities and other specific subjects.The idea is to let companies tap into Facebook’s vast trove of user data on an anonymous basis to learn more about what consumers like, think, and do, albeit on an anonymous basis.
